810 Dempster St. Evanston,
IL 60202 | hewnbread.com
Hewn is a small, independently-owned and operated bakery in Evanston. All products are made from scratch using organic flour and grain. The breads are all hand-mixed, hand-shaped, and naturally fermented. Hewn also collaborates with local farms to source their grains, produce, and dairy. The bread selections rotate daily. Each day, the menu consists of the store’s country loaf, blonde country loaf, and four or more rotating specialty loaves. Everything from challah to caramelized onion rye has been featured.
Many of the interior furnishings were salvaged and repurposed from old material in order to create a genuine, rustic atmosphere for customers. The owner’s eye for design has allowed the store’s interior to accurately reflect the warm, rustic nature of their bread.

5927 W Lawrence Ave.
Portage Park | delightfulpastries.com
Start your morning right with some savory Chicago pastries. Since 1998, this quaint bakery has served authentic mouth-watering European pastries to its fanatic customers. The mother-daughter duo who founded the bakery wanted to use natural ingredients for their pastries that did not end up completely covered with sugar. Instead, they wanted the natural flavors of the pastry to shine through. Most of their pastries are made with low-sugar. None of them contain any chemicals or preservatives.

4655 N Lincoln Ave. Ravenswood,
Lincoln Square | bakermillerchicago.com
Need a fresh-baked pastry to start your day? Maybe you also want something less sweet and more savory to help you stay full until lunch. Either way, you have come to the right place. Baker Miller offers a full breakfast menu that appeals to all taste buds. Along with its bakery kitchen, Baker Miller also has a full savory kitchen for serving breakfast and lunch.
The Bakery offers a variety of pastries, breads, and pies. The pastry types rotate per whim and season, but there are some pastries that they usually offer no matter the time or the season. These include their Blueberry Oat Muffins, Bacon Cheddar Hand Pies, Sourdough Cinnamon Rolls, Biscuits, and Key Lime Pie.

3025 W Diversey Ave.
Logan Square | cellardoorprovisions.com
Cellar Door Provisions is a daytime cafe and nighttime bistro in Logan Square that serves cooking sourced from the Midwest. The menu changes weekly according to seasonal demands. For pastries, they serve Canneles, Scones, Croissants, and Kouign Amanns. They also offer a comprehensive breakfast menu comprised of savory items such as the Quiche, Spanish Tortilla, and the Sourdough Flatbread.

3329 N Lincoln Ave.
Lakeview | dinkels.com
Dine-in or order delivery at one of Chicago’s most popular bakeries. In the mood for something sweet? Dinkel’s serves a variety of sweets baked daily at the store. Donuts, Fritters, Coffee Cakes, Danishes, Cinnamon Buns, Caramel Pecan Rolls and more are served fresh every day. For something more savory, try the Stuffed Croissants or the Quiche.
Just don’t forget to try the bakery’s World Famous Stollen. Pure butter yeast is raised before being filled with almonds, cashews, pineapple, and golden raisins that were soaked overnight in rum and brandy. After being baked, the bread is glazed in butter and lightly dusted with powdered sugar.

7055 W Archer Ave.
Garfield Ridge | webersbakery.com
Weber’s Bakery is one of Chicago’s oldest and finest bakeries. Since 1930, Weber’s has served a large variety of high-quality breads, pastries, and cakes to happy customers. Each item is baked from scratch every morning. For new customers, we recommend picking something from the Signature Items menu. Chocolate Cake Donuts, Kolacky, and Buttermilk Poundcake are just a few delectable items featured on it.

820 W Randolph St. West Loop,
Near West Side | littlegoatchicago.com
Little Goat Diner houses a bakery that serves fresh-baked bread every morning. Customers can watch the baker and his team feed starters, make doughs, and scale out rolls every morning. White, quinoa sourdough, rye, and bacon gouda bread are served every day. Guests can also stop by for coffee cake, croissants, bagels, cupcakes, cookies, and more.
